Located on the limestone plateaus, this terroir is unique due to the fact that its limestone soil reveals traces of iron.These deposits vary in concentration throughout the soil and they design their collection of wines according to its characteristics with very meticulous agricultural techniques.

Organic since 2007, Lucie and her sister Nancy are growing this 10 Ha estate situated in Mercurol, in the heart of the Crozes-Hermitage appellation.
With bio-dynamic certifications and natural vinification, the wines are made with very little interventions and minimum addition of sulphites.
